While the traditional majorette style of dancing involves baton twirling and 8-count arm movements, The MADD House focuses on the more modern "Hip-Hop Majorette" style of dance made popular by HBCU marching band dance-lines of the south. The 1968 Orange Blossom Classic, an annual HBCU football sporting event in Florida, hosted the first known majorette performance with the introduction of Alcorn State University's Golden Girls majorette team. This majorette-style dance, also called dance lines or hip-hop majoretting, began in the late 1960s at historically black colleges and universities, or HBCUs.
